What Is the Official Status of Hytale Mods?
Hytale was built with modding as a core part of the game rather than an afterthought. Official posts describe a server-side-first model, asset tools, creative tools, data-driven content, and a long-term plan for modders to build worlds, items, NPCs, systems, UI, and custom experiences. That does not mean every file you find in search results is safe or official.
The important distinction is source control. A real Hytale mod should be connected to a known creator, a recognized mod hub, an official contest page, a trusted server, or clear documentation. A vague download button promising unlimited Hytale mods, Android mod menus, free premium access, or a no-launcher crack is a different risk category.
This guide focuses on safe discovery and practical setup. It does not claim that every mod format, browser feature, or cross-platform workflow is final forever. Hytale is evolving through updates, so players and creators should verify the current launcher, support, and patch-note behavior before installing or publishing mods.
Where Should You Get Hytale Mods?
Use this table to separate high-trust mod sources from risky shortcuts. Trust is not only about the domain name; it is also about whether the file, creator, version, and instructions are traceable.
| Source | Best use | Safety check |
|---|---|---|
| Official Hytale news, support, and launcher | Understanding current mod support, requirements, and game updates | Prefer official instructions for launcher behavior, supported platforms, and account security. |
| CurseForge or contest-managed pages | Finding public community mods and event submissions | Check creator name, update date, version notes, dependencies, comments, and moderation signals. |
| Trusted community documentation | Learning concepts, tool setup, and examples | Use docs for learning, but download executable files only when the source chain is clear. |
| A private or community server | Joining server-side experiences that load content through the server | Confirm the server reputation, rules, region, moderation policy, and whether it asks you to run extra files. |
| Mirror ZIPs, repacks, cracked launchers, APK mod menus | Not recommended | Avoid these. They often mix mod intent with account risk, malware risk, or unsupported mobile claims. |
How Hytale Mods Work in Practice
Hytale modding is different from the old habit of downloading a large client-side pack and hoping every dependency matches. Official communication emphasizes that the host of the game or server matters. In many cases, players should be able to join a modded experience without manually juggling a folder full of client mods.
For players, the practical question is simple: do you need to install a file yourself, or does the server provide the experience? If a server claims you must run a separate launcher, disable security, install an APK, or use a cracked account flow, slow down and verify the claim against official guidance.
For creators, the workflow is broader. Hytale's creator ecosystem includes asset editing, Blockbench-oriented model work, world generation tools, data configuration, scripts, and server-side behavior. That creates room for simple cosmetic packs, custom worlds, RPG systems, minigames, creative tools, and deep server experiences.
Server-side-first experiences
A server-side-first model reduces the need for every player to manually match a mod list. It also makes server operators responsible for version control, compatibility testing, and moderation.
Asset and data-driven content
Many Hytale customizations can be built around assets, configuration, models, brushes, NPC behavior, and world-generation pieces. This makes modding accessible to creators who are not full-time programmers.
Code mods and deeper systems
More advanced creators may work with APIs, server logic, or plugin-style behavior. These files deserve stricter review because they can affect server stability, performance, and security.
Mobile and APK claims
A Hytale mod file is not the same thing as a verified Android APK. Treat Hytale mobile mod downloads, mod menus, and APK packs as unverified unless official Hytale sources confirm that platform and workflow.
Safe Hytale Mods Setup Checklist
Before installing, enabling, or joining a modded Hytale experience, run through these checks. They take less time than recovering a corrupted world or compromised account.
- Confirm that your Hytale launcher and game build are current before testing mods.
- Read the mod page for supported game version, dependencies, known issues, and update date.
- Prefer files linked from a recognized mod hub, official contest page, or trusted creator profile.
- Back up saves, worlds, and server folders before enabling any new mod.
- Test one mod at a time in a staging world instead of changing a live server immediately.
- Avoid any mod that asks for account credentials, browser cookies, unrelated installers, or antivirus exclusions.
- Keep server mods, client files, logs, backups, and downloaded archives in clearly labeled folders.
- Remove a mod first if crashes, missing assets, or version mismatch warnings begin after installation.

Common Hytale Mod Problems
Most mod issues are version, dependency, or source problems. Start with the newest change instead of reinstalling everything.
| Problem | Likely cause | First fix |
|---|---|---|
| Game or server will not start | Unsupported game build, missing dependency, or incompatible mod | Disable the newest mod, check logs, and verify supported versions. |
| Missing textures or models | Asset pack mismatch or incomplete download | Re-download from the original source and test in a clean world. |
| Friends cannot join a modded server | Server version, whitelist, region, or mod validation issue | Test with a clean profile and review the server logs. |
| Performance drops | Heavy world generation, too many scripts, or host limits | Lower server load and test each mod separately. |
| A page promises Android mod support | Unverified mobile APK or mod-menu claim | Check the Hytale Android status before downloading anything. |
